VARIABLE INTEREST ENTITIES
In connection with the Arysta Acquisition, the Company acquired ownership in two distributors deemed to be variable interest entities.
Saphyto S.A.
The Company holds a 45.0% interest in its product distributor, Saphyto S.A. The Company's has determined that it is the primarily beneficiary of the activities of Saphyto S.A., as approximately 94.0% of the distributor's sales are based on the Company's products and it has the power to direct activities impacting Saphyto S.A.'s economic performance. As a result, the activities of Saphyto S.A. are consolidated in the Company's condensed consolidated financial statements.
Societe das Produits Industriels et Agricoles, or SPIA
The Company holds a 31.95% interest in its product distributor, SPIA. The Company has determined that although it receives a disproportionate amount of economic benefit as compared to its ownership interest, it is not the primarily beneficiary of the activities of SPIA, as the majority shareholder of SPIA holds a 50.9% interest and exercises control through voting rights. As a result, the Company has applied equity method of accounting to its interest in SPIA. SPIA's total assets are approximately $7.2 million.
